William Shepherd was born in 1649 in Upton On Severn, Worcester, England, the child of John Sheapherd and Christian Shipherd. William Shepherd married Elizabeth \ Elspeth \ Elspet Frazer ( Stiven ? ), and had children including Joseph Shephard. William Shepherd passed away in 1718 in Shropshire, England.
